About This Home
Beautiful two-story house - excellent setting in an attractive, well-established Arden neighborhood. Pretty hardwood floors are throughout the main level; all new carpet upstairs! A sweet front porch opens into the entry foyer with the powder room, a coat closet, and the formal dining room to the right. At the rear of the home are the open and spacious living room, kitchen, and eat-in dining area, featuring a cozy gas fireplace and sliding doors to access the back deck and yard. The kitchen has an efficient layout and stainless appliances including the electric range, built-in microwave, refrigerator, dishwasher, and garbage disposal. Upstairs are three bedrooms, both full bathrooms, the laundry room, and a large landing. The primary bedroom includes a walk-in closet and a large en suite bathroom with a double sink vanity, jetted tub, and separate shower. The second full bathroom has a combination bathtub/shower. The washer and dryer will remain for tenant use, but these appliances will not be repaired or replaced by the homeowner. The inviting backyard has a large deck and is surrounded by mature trees, with a shed available for tenant use. Tenants are responsible for all utilities and lawn care. Central heat and air conditioning with a heat pump for each floor. Ceiling fans throughout. No cosigners. No smoking. No pets.

A wooded, rural neighborhood surrounds Lake Julian, complete with fantastic mountain views and winding country lanes. But the lake itself is the star of this neighborhood -- it is a popular destination for boating and fishing. Lake Julian Park is located on the banks of the 300-acre lake, providing a picturesque location for picnics and games like horseshoes and sand volleyball. Visitors can rent paddle boats or use the boat launch, or they can enjoy this popular fishing location's abundance of crappie, bass, catfish, tilapia, and brim. Lake Julian Park is on the north side of the lake.
While Lake Julian feels like a lakeside retreat in the Smoky Mountains, this cozy neighborhood is also convenient -- it is about nine miles south of Downtown Asheville and less than five miles north of Asheville Regional Airport. Shoppers appreciate the nearby Biltmore Park Town Square, a mixed-use development offering a variety of shops and restaurants.
